This commit is contained in:
Alejandro Sarmiento
2024-03-11 20:18:17 +01:00
parent 5b2858e84d
commit 797096e18f

View File

@@ -27,14 +27,14 @@ pipeline {
def imageName = "clean-architecture-backend:${version}"
withCredentials([string(credentialsId: 'docker-registry-url', variable: 'REGISTRY_URL')]) {
def fullImageName = "${REGISTRY_URL}/${imageName}"
def fullImageName = "[string(credentialsId: 'docker-registry-url', variable: 'REGISTRY_URL')]/${imageName}"
echo "FULL IMAGE NAME || FULL IMAGE NAME || FULL IMAGE NAME || FULL IMAGE NAME || FULL IMAGE NAME || FULL IMAGE NAME "
echo 'Full Image Name: ${fullImageName}'
// Construir la imagen
sh "docker build --build-arg ENVIRONMENT=${ASP_ENVIRONMENT} -t ${imageName} ./CleanArchitecture/"
// Login y Push usando withDockerRegistry
docker.withRegistry("${REGISTRY_URL}", 'dockerregistryalexdev') {
docker.withRegistry("[string(credentialsId: 'docker-registry-url', variable: 'REGISTRY_URL')]", 'dockerregistryalexdev') {
sh "docker tag ${imageName} ${fullImageName}"
sh "docker push ${fullImageName}"
}